In total we travelled 1973 miles from Bath to Geneva and back (1018 outbound and 955 return). The whole trip was extremely simple and easy and I would encourage everyone to get out and road trip

Thanks to David Peilow here's an example of what becomes possible with a 200 mile range EV and 17kW AC 'fast' charging... Bath to Zurich in easy 2 day drive ('hard' 1 day drive)
